Jadupur - Mahakalapada, Kendrapara

Jadupur is a village situated in the Mahakalapada tehsil of Kendrapara district, Odisha. It is located approximately 19 km from Marsaghai and around 40 km from Kendrapara . Jadupur village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Jadupur is 396933. The village covers a total geographical area of 297 hectares and falls under the 754213 pincode. Kendrapara is the nearest town, located about 19 km away.

Jadupur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Mahakalapada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Kendrapara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Jadupur

As per Census 2011, Jadupur village has a total population of 2,982 people, consisting of 1,498 males and 1,484 females. The village has 636 households and a sex ratio of 990 females per 1,000 males. There are 279 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 2,256 literate and 726 illiterate residents. Additionally, 897 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 1 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
